Pandas isin not. Pandas library does not have the With invert=True, isin () now returns True for values not in [‘Red’, ‘Blue’] and False for values that are in the set. Pandas library does not have the direct NOT IN filter in Python, but we can perform the NOT IN filter by negating the isin () operator of Pandas. isin () and The pandas equivalent to SQL NOT IN expression Likewise, we could simply negate the result from isin() method in order to achieve the pandas pandas. # create a list of values to filter Learn how to use the Pandas isin method to filter your data like SQL's IN and NOT IN statements, on Pandas Dataframe columns. isin(values) [source] # Whether elements in Series are contained in values. Think of the tilde (~) as the "NOT" operator in Pandas. Return a boolean Series showing whether each element in the Series matches an element in the Pandas NOT IN (~) operator filter is used to check whether a particular data is available in the DataFrame or not. It flips the boolean values returned by isin(), helping you filter out specific values instead of Here is an example of how to filter a DataFrame for rows where a column has a value that is not in a list: # create a sample DataFrame . Since this is an elementwise operation that does not depend on index alignment, there are very few situations where this method is not an appropriate replacement for pandas' isin. Series. This article demonstrates how to filter Pandas DataFrame using IN and Not IN operators like in SQL. In Since this is an elementwise operation that does not depend on index alignment, there are very few situations where this method is not an appropriate replacement for pandas' isin. Key Takeaways about isin () pandas. . Get Job-Ready: Data Analysis using Python with 70+ Projects Start Now!! Program 1 import pandas as pd emp=pd. Pandas don’t have a NOT IN The isin() method checks if the Dataframe contains the specified value (s). In today’s short tutorial we will be showcasing how to use the pandas equivalent to SQL IN and NOT IN expressions. isin # Series. xlsx") #select * from emp The "NOT IN" (∼) filter is a membership operator used to check whether the data is present in DataFrame or not. read_excel("E:mypandasemployee. It returns a DataFrame similar to the original DataFrame, but the original values have been replaced with True if the value Learn how to use the Pandas isin method to filter your data like SQL's IN and NOT IN statements, on Pandas Dataframe columns. This tutorial explains how to perform a "not in" filter in a pandas DataFrame, including several examples. To check if values is not in the DataFrame, use the ~ operator: When values is a dict, we can pass values to check for each column separately: When values is a Series or DataFrame the index and Use Pandas NOT IN filter (~isin) to retrieve rows not matching values in a list; apply to columns like strings, numbers, datetimes, and more. Additionally, we will also This tutorial explains how to perform a "not in" filter in a pandas DataFrame, including several examples. szujw vyl zrhv kegswb bdqjfw tvei tjliosj otfbq oamnktnd tqphc lconvp llknxn jayh iri cbhg